Kropz (LON:KRPZ) Shares Up 6.7% – Here’s Why

Kropz plc (LON:KRPZGet Free Report) traded up 6.7% on Monday . The company traded as high as GBX 1.60 and last traded at GBX 1.60. 713,578 shares were traded during mid-day trading, an increase of 211% from the average session volume of 229,710 shares. The stock had previously closed at GBX 1.50.

Kropz Stock Performance

The stock has a fifty day simple moving average of GBX 0.74 and a 200-day simple moving average of GBX 0.60. The stock has a market cap of £25.08 million, a P/E ratio of 2.05 and a beta of -0.10.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 125.65, a quick ratio of 0.15 and a current ratio of 0.21.

Kropz Company Profile

(Get Free Report)

Kropz is an emerging plant nutrient producer with an advanced stage phosphate mining project in South Africa and a phosphate project in the Republic of Congo (‘RoC’). The vision of the Kropz Group is to become a leading independent phosphate rock producer and to develop into an integrated, mine-to-market plant nutrient company focusing on sub-Saharan Africa.

Kropz’s Elandsfontein Phosphate Project is a near-term producing asset in South Africa’s Western Cape Province, close to export infrastructure and primed to take advantage of a recovery in phosphate prices.
